Output df811daab84850765264b3d8ede372e093bc4605a402e5fd9018efbbbfaff193:0

value
33877599
script pubkey
OP_0 OP_PUSHBYTES_20 30370b160aa72c5c157d8bdce3704d87872e9ef6
address
bc1qxqmsk9s25uk9c9ta30wwxuzds7rja8hkuwd5cv
transaction
df811daab84850765264b3d8ede372e093bc4605a402e5fd9018efbbbfaff193
confirmations
289546
spent
true